What happened
Andrew Yakubu served as Group Managing Director of the Nigerian National Petroleum Corporation (NNPC) from 2014 to 2015, during President Goodluck Jonathan's administration. His tenure at the helm of Nigeria's state oil company was brief but became the subject of intense scrutiny years later. In 2017, the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) arrested and arraigned Yakubu on corruption charges related to his time at the NNPC.
Yakubu's case emerged during a broader anti-corruption campaign launched by President Muhammadu Buhari's administration, which targeted former officials from the previous government. The charges against him were part of investigations into alleged financial mismanagement and corruption within the NNPC during the Jonathan era. His prosecution became one of several high-profile cases that highlighted ongoing challenges in Nigeria's oil sector governance and accountability.
